摘要:
The aim of the present study was to ascertain whether multiparous sows could successfully be inseminated with sexed semen non-surgically. Spermatozoa were stained with Hoechst 33342 and separated flowcytometrically in X- and Y-chromosome bearing sperm populations employing the Beltsville Sperm Sexing Technology (BSST). After weaning, estrus was induced in sows with PMSG and hCG. Animals were inseminated once per estrus non-surgically with a specially designed catheter into the tip of the uterine horn, employing 50 x 106 of either sexed or non-sexed spermatozoa diluted in 2 ml Androhep (TM). Pregnant sows were allowed to go to term. Mean pregnancy rate from inseminations with unsexed spermatozoa was 54.5% whereas inseminations with sexed spermatozoa resulted in 33.3% pregnant sows. All but one piglet born after insemination with sexed semen were of the predicted sex. The sex of those piglets born after inseminations with non-sexed spermatozoa was 61.1% for male and 38.9% for female sex. It is concluded that non-surgically inseminations with flowcytometrically sexed spermatozoa can be conducted successfully. (c) 2004 Elsevier Inc. All rights reserved.
